What are foil balloons and how are they different from latex balloons?

Foil balloons are made from a thin, metallic polyamide film, often referred to as Mylar. Unlike latex balloons, which are made from natural rubber, foil balloons have a smooth, shiny surface that holds helium significantly longer—often for several days or even weeks, depending on conditions. They are available in a wide range of shapes, sizes, and printed designs.

The key differences between foil and latex balloons come down to material, longevity, and use case. Latex balloons are biodegradable and more affordable, making them ideal for large-volume decorating. Foil balloons, on the other hand, are prized for their visual impact, durability, and ability to carry detailed printed graphics. This makes them especially popular for themed parties, personalised events, and premium decorations where presentation matters.

Foil balloons also behave differently when inflated. They hold their shape more rigidly, which makes them well suited to number balloons, letter balloons, and character shapes. Many foil balloons can even be deflated and reused, which adds practical value for retailers and decorators alike.

Who can buy foil balloons from a wholesale supplier?

Wholesale foil balloons are primarily available to businesses rather than individual consumers. Typical buyers include party supply retailers, event decorators, balloon artists, florists, supermarkets, and online shop owners. Some wholesalers also supply other distributors, who then sell on to smaller retailers in their region.

In most cases, you will need to demonstrate that you are purchasing for business purposes. This often means registering with the wholesaler using a company name, VAT number, or trade registration. The exact requirements vary by supplier, but the intention is to ensure that wholesale pricing and terms are reserved for trade buyers.

Consumer buyers are generally not excluded from all wholesale channels, but they are unlikely to meet minimum order thresholds or qualify for trade pricing. If you are an individual looking to buy foil balloons in large quantities for a one-off event, it is worth contacting suppliers directly to ask about their policies.

What minimum order quantities apply to wholesale foil balloons?

Minimum order quantities for wholesale foil balloons vary between suppliers, but most require buyers to purchase by the case, box, or to meet a minimum order value. Case sizes commonly range from 10 to 50 units per design, depending on the balloon size and type. Some suppliers set a minimum order value rather than a unit-based threshold.

Smaller foil balloons, such as standard 18-inch round designs, tend to have higher case quantities because they are produced and sold in larger volumes. Larger or more specialised shapes, such as oversized number balloons or licensed character balloons, may be available in smaller case quantities due to their higher individual value.

It is important to factor minimum order requirements into your purchasing plan, especially if you are stocking a retail shop or preparing for a seasonal spike in demand. Ordering in line with minimum quantities, rather than trying to mix and match small numbers of many designs, typically results in better pricing and smoother fulfilment.

How do you choose a reliable foil balloon wholesale supplier?

Choosing a reliable wholesale foil balloon supplier comes down to four key factors: product quality, range, pricing transparency, and service consistency. A trustworthy supplier will be clear about their terms, responsive to trade enquiries, and able to provide product information, including safety certifications.

When evaluating suppliers, consider the following:

  • Product safety compliance: Foil balloons sold in Europe should meet relevant safety standards. Ask suppliers whether their products comply with the Toy Safety Directive 2009/48/EC or equivalent standards.
  • Range and availability: A good wholesale supplier should carry a broad and regularly updated range of designs, including seasonal and trending styles.
  • Membership in industry bodies: Suppliers affiliated with organisations such as the European Balloon and Party Council are more likely to stay current with industry regulations and best practices.
  • Delivery reliability: Check lead times, shipping costs, and whether the supplier has the warehouse infrastructure to fulfil orders consistently.
  • Minimum order flexibility: Some suppliers are more flexible than others, particularly for new trade customers. It is worth asking about introductory terms.

Building a long-term relationship with a supplier who understands your business needs is far more valuable than chasing the lowest price on a one-off order. Consistency, communication, and product quality matter more over time.

What types of foil balloons are most popular for wholesale orders?

The most popular foil balloons for wholesale orders tend to be number balloons, letter balloons, star-shaped balloons, and round printed designs for key occasions such as birthdays, weddings, and seasonal celebrations. These designs have consistent year-round demand and form the core stock for most party supply retailers and decorators.

Beyond the classics, licensed character balloons tied to popular film and television franchises are consistently strong sellers, particularly in the children’s party segment. Seasonal designs for events like Valentine’s Day, Halloween, and Christmas also drive significant wholesale volumes in the lead-up to each occasion.

Trend-driven shapes such as organic balloon designs, large walking animal balloons, and giant number sets have grown in popularity as social media has raised expectations for event decoration. Wholesalers who keep their range current with these trends tend to be more valuable partners for decorators and retailers who want to stay competitive.

Can I order a mix of different foil balloon designs in a single wholesale order?

Yes, most wholesale suppliers allow you to combine different designs within a single order, though each individual design will still need to meet its own minimum case quantity. For example, if a supplier requires a minimum of 10 units per design, you could order 10 units of five different designs to reach a larger order value. It is worth confirming the supplier's exact mixing policy before placing your first order, as some offer more flexibility for established trade accounts.

What is the typical lead time for a wholesale foil balloon order?

Lead times vary depending on the supplier's warehouse location, stock availability, and your delivery address, but most European wholesale suppliers can fulfil standard orders within 2 to 5 business days. For large or custom orders, or during peak seasonal periods such as before Valentine's Day or Christmas, lead times can extend significantly. Planning your orders 2 to 4 weeks ahead of peak demand is a good practice to avoid stockouts and ensure timely delivery.

Are there any storage requirements I should be aware of when buying foil balloons in bulk?

Foil balloons should be stored flat, in a cool, dry environment away from direct sunlight, sharp objects, and excessive heat, all of which can degrade the metallic film and cause premature leaking. Avoid stacking heavy items on top of stored balloon stock, and keep them in their original packaging until needed. Proper storage can preserve product quality for 1 to 2 years, making bulk purchasing a practical and low-risk option for retailers with adequate storage space.

What is the difference between helium-filled and air-filled foil balloons, and does it affect wholesale buying decisions?

Foil balloons can be inflated with either helium, which makes them float, or air, which keeps them grounded but is far more cost-effective for large installations and display purposes. Many decorators use air-filled foil balloons on sticks or as part of balloon walls and arches where floating is not required. When buying wholesale, it is worth stocking both helium-grade foil balloons and designs suitable for air inflation, as the demand for air-filled decorating has grown significantly alongside organic and structured balloon styling trends.

How do I handle a situation where wholesale foil balloons arrive damaged or defective?

When receiving a wholesale order, inspect the delivery promptly and document any damage with photographs before accepting or signing off on the shipment. Reputable wholesale suppliers will have a clear returns or claims policy for damaged or defective goods, typically requiring you to report issues within a specified window, often 24 to 48 hours of delivery. Establishing a trade account with a supplier who has a transparent and responsive after-sales process is one of the most important steps you can take to protect your business from fulfilment issues.

What should I look for in terms of product safety certifications when sourcing foil balloons wholesale?

When sourcing foil balloons for the European market, look for products that comply with the Toy Safety Directive 2009/48/EC, which sets out safety requirements for balloon products that may be handled by children. Reputable suppliers should be able to provide documentation such as CE markings or test reports upon request. Selling non-compliant products can expose your business to legal liability and reputational damage, so verifying certifications before committing to a supplier is a non-negotiable step in your due diligence process.
